Following the withdrawal of Felbridge from our scheduled fixture, Nuthurst travelled to a new opponent, Langton Green. Having had a couple of tough matches the Nutters were keen to make a return to winning ways. We welcomed back Captain Bob from his recent travels to add his tactical prowess to his teams armoury!
Langton Green won the toss and elected to bat. An early wicket for Chippie (24 - 1) saw Langton 16 for 1, however Langton skipper Ben Allatt along with No 3 bat Hughes proceeded to add 90 runs in a free scoring partnership that threatened to put the game beyond Nuthurst. Jeremy James (70 - 3 ) and Will Rossiter (20 - 0) were particularly harshly dealt with. Jez's persistence and accuracy were finally rewarded with 3 wickets, including a fantastic caught and bowled as Hughes sent an "exocet" in his direction!
Having seen off the Langton Green's top order the Nuthurst bowlers in the shape of Jonny Willis (25 - 2), Simon Whitehouse (17 - 1) and Keith Greenwood (17 - 3) took regular wickets, aided by some good fielding (great to see how calmly Nathan Williams took his first catch for the club) saw Langton reduced to 191 all out in 37 overs.
Nuthurst made a solid start in reply David Butcher (15) and Will Rossiter (32) posting a 50 run opening partnership, both fell with the score on 53. Samways (18) and Willis (73) then set about rebuilding. Willis in addition to making his second 50 of the season, remarkably out ran the normally "nimble" Samways whilst building their partnership. James Simpson (15) and Charlie South (18) made good contributions as Nuthurst cruised to a comfortable and welcome victory.
